Haiti - Culture : The Ambassador of Haiti to the opening of the exhibition of Philippe Dodard

Paul G. Altidor, Ambassador of Haiti to the United States, paid a visit as guest of honor at the Community Folk Art Center (CFAC) to Syracuse (New York) for the opening of the exhibition "Philippe Dodard : The Idea of Modernity in Haitian Contemporary Art", which showcases the rich history and vibrant art scene in Haiti. "We're trying to promote Haiti in a different way, so the idea of Haitian art is a way of showcasing a different side of Haiti," declared Ambassador Altidor.

The exhibition is held at 805 E. Genesee Street, Syracuse, NY 13210, every week from Tuesday to Saturday from 1:00 pm to 3:00 pm, until December 7, 2013. Free admission for the community.

Learn more about the CFAC :

Community Folk Art Center, Inc. (CFAC), is a vibrant cultural and artistic hub committed to the promotion and development of artists of the African Diaspora. The mission of the center is to exalt cultural and artistic pluralism by collecting, exhibiting, teaching and interpreting the visual and performing arts. It is supported in part with public funds from the New York State Council on the Arts.

Learn more about Philippe Dodard :

Philippe Dodard (born 1954) is a Haitian graphic artist and painter. Born in Port-au-Prince, Dodard worked as an advertising illustrator. His works have been exhibited throughout Europe and the Americas. He received the first prize in drawing at the Junior Seminary of St-Martial's College in 1966. He studied at the PotoMitan Art School with Jean-Claude "Tiga" Garoute, Patrick Vilaire and Frido Casimir. In 1973, he entered the Academy of Fine Arts. Then he worked as layout artist and founded a studio of audiovisual graphic arts. In 1978, he received a scholarship to the International School in Bordeaux, France, enabling him to specialize in Pedagogic Graphic Design. Two years later he received a scholarship from the Rotary International Foundation and left on tour with the Group Study Exchange of Haiti to give conferences on Haitian culture. His artwork has evolved to include large sculptures, fine iron works and fine jewelry design.
